Domaine Goisot: Biodynamic Burgundy That Won’t Break the Bank

Domaine Goisot: Biodynamic Burgundy That Won’t Break the Bank
“… the truth of the matter is that quality is shoulder-to-shoulder with far more famous labels. In Goisot, we have a grower as meticulous and as principled as you will find anywhere and the results can be seen in the glass.” Neal Martin, The Wine Advocate
“The estate is totally biodynamic and makes wines of remarkable purity and concentration ... Simply stunning.” Bettane and Desseauve’s Guide to the Wines of France
“No one but no one delivers more quality for the price than Goisot. The quality is flat out amazing, particularly given the modest appellations with which he works.” Allen Meadows, Burghound

As many of our clients will already know, this pioneering, biodynamic domaine in Yonne (the same department of Burgundy that includes Chablis) produces some of the most exciting terroir-rich wines of Burgundy and some of this region’s most outstanding value. For a domaine that works in a “modest” (Meadows) area that most wine lovers have never heard of, Goisot has earned an unprecedented reputation in France. To give you some idea, the late Anne-Claude Leflaive once described Goisot as “a superstar!” when we had mentioned we were visiting Saint-Bris the following day. Praise indeed.

How has such a humble, out-of-the-way grower broken into the Burgundy elite? In short, Goisot farms some of northern Burgundy’s purest limestone vineyards (pictured above); possesses a large proportion of old, massale selected vines; and cuts no corners in the perfectionist, biodynamic vineyard work and precise élevage.

The bewitching 2019 vintage delivered a super-rare combination of ripeness and freshness, with acidity levels similar to the exciting and racy Chardonnay vintages of ‘17 and ‘14. To quote Allen Meadows: “Fans of the domaine are used to seeing it consistently outperform with the modest appellations that it has, and they have done so again in 2019.”
